What's The Definition Of Cuneate?
[adj] of a leaf shape; narrowly triangular, wider at the apex and tapering toward the base
Synonyms | Synonyms for Cuneate: simple | unsubdivided | wedge-shaped Related Terms | Find terms related to Cuneate: See Also | Cuneate In Webster's Dictionary \Cu"ne*ate\ (k?"n?-?t), Cuneated \Cu"ne*a`ted\ (-?`tEd),
a. [L. cuneatus, fr. cuneus a wege See{Coin}.]
Wedge-shaped; (Bot.), wedge-shaped, with the point at the
base; as, a cuneate leaf.
